Airfoil Design for a Prescribed Velocity Distribution in Transonic Flow by an Integral MethodIn the present paper a method for the design of airfoils for a prescribed transonic contour velocity distribution is developed. It applies the fundamental ideas of the integral method after K. Oswatitsch for the prediction of the velocity distribution on a given airfoil in nonlinear compressible flow.

Some Developments in Unsteady Transonic Flow Researchproblems. The study of unsteady flows helps one to achieve an improved understanding of steady flows, in particular as to the permanence and realizability of a particular steady flow and how typical transonic nonlinear effects develop in time.
